Secretary Wanted in Pretoria at Adams & Adams
Duties and responsibilities
- Provide day-to-day secretarial and administrative support to the GBU team.
- Manage diaries, correspondence and general document preparation.
- Handle urgent matters promptly and ensure timely completion of tasks.
- Draft standard legal and administrative documents, including affidavits, agreements, schedules and letters of demand.
- Maintain accurate diary entries, Patricia records and related filing systems.
- Assist with managing litigious matters and related case administration.
- Monitor e-commerce platforms and identify potential investigation targets.
- Prepare monthly reports to clients on anti-counterfeiting activities.
- Support investigation-related administrative processes.
- Liaise with clients, agents, SAPS, SARS, CIPC and other relevant stakeholders.
- Prepare draft correspondence and precedent affidavits for submission where required.
- Respond professionally to telephone and written enquiries.
- Maintain training schedules and coordinate invitations, reminders and post-training reports.
- Assist with invoicing and billing administration.

Requirements
• A relevant legal diploma/certificate with proven litigation support experience in IP/anti-counterfeiting.
• Three years post-matric experience or an equivalent qualification.
• Experience working on Patricia and CMS will be advantageous.
• Additional training in trademark law or brand enforcement will be advantageous.
